Old Miami Detroit, United States, situated at 3930 Cass, is a legendary fixture in the city’s vibrant nightlife scene, renowned for its gritty charm and authentic Detroit club atmosphere. Established in the early 2000s, this intimate venue quickly gained a reputation for hosting some of the most electrifying club nights, drawing electronic music enthusiasts from across the globe. Over the years, Old Miami has maintained its raw, unpretentious vibe, making it a favorite among locals and visitors alike who seek an authentic Detroit experience.
The venue has seen minimal structural changes, preserving its vintage aesthetic that perfectly complements Detroit’s storied musical heritage. Its dance floors have witnessed unforgettable nights filled with pulsating beats, where the city’s underground scene thrives and newcomers discover the magic of Detroit’s electronic music culture. Old Miami’s reputation is further solidified by its association with the SESH community, which consistently highlights it as a must-visit spot for those exploring Detroit’s nightlife.
The venue has hosted a stellar lineup of artists, both international and local, who have left a lasting impression on its patrons. Among the most celebrated performers are Dru Ruiz, known for her deep, soulful sets; Stacey Pullen, a Detroit native whose pioneering techno sounds have become legendary; Sinistarr, whose energetic productions keep the dance floor alive; DJ Three, a staple in the local scene; PM, Ohashi, Claymore, Nitin, Ostara, and Taimur—each bringing their unique styles to the club’s eclectic mix of electronic music. These artists have helped cement Old Miami’s status as a hub for innovative sounds and unforgettable nights.
